Oracle8教程掌握数据库新技能

Oracle 8是一个功能强大的关系数据库管理系统,它提供了一种高效、可靠的数据管理解决方案,在这篇文章中,我们将学习如何使用Oracle 8来掌握数据库的新技能。

1、安装和配置Oracle 8

Oracle8教程掌握数据库新技能

我们需要安装和配置Oracle 8,以下是安装和配置Oracle 8的步骤:

下载并安装Oracle 8软件包,确保您已经下载了适用于您的操作系统的Oracle 8软件包。

运行安装程序,双击下载的Oracle 8软件包,然后按照屏幕上的提示进行操作。

设置环境变量,在安装过程中,您需要设置一些环境变量,以便系统能够找到Oracle 8的安装位置。

创建Oracle用户,为了保护您的系统安全,您需要在系统中创建一个专门的Oracle用户。

创建数据库实例,在Oracle 8中,数据库实例是一组共享相同内存结构和后台进程的数据库,要创建数据库实例,您需要运行“dbca”命令。

创建数据库,要创建数据库,您需要运行“create database”命令。

2、学习SQL语言

SQL(结构化查询语言)是用于管理和操作关系数据库的标准语言,要使用Oracle 8,您需要学习SQL语言的基本语法和概念,以下是一些基本的SQL语句:

SELECT:用于从数据库表中检索数据。

INSERT:用于向数据库表中插入新的记录。

UPDATE:用于更新数据库表中的现有记录。

DELETE:用于从数据库表中删除记录。

CREATE:用于创建新表或修改现有表的结构。

Oracle8教程掌握数据库新技能

ALTER:用于修改现有表的结构。

DROP:用于删除表或索引。

3、学习PL/SQL编程

PL/SQL(过程语言/结构化查询语言)是一种用于编写Oracle存储过程、触发器和函数的程序设计语言,要使用PL/SQL编程,您需要学习以下内容:

PL/SQL基本语法和结构。

控制结构,如IF、FOR循环和WHILE循环。

异常处理。

游标和集合操作。

存储过程、触发器和函数的创建和使用。

4、学习数据字典和性能调优

数据字典是Oracle中存储有关数据库对象(如表、索引、视图等)的信息的地方,要有效地使用Oracle,您需要熟悉数据字典的使用,性能调优是确保数据库运行得尽可能快的过程,以下是一些性能调优的技巧:

确保表有适当的索引。

优化查询语句,避免全表扫描和笛卡尔积操作。

使用分区表来提高查询性能。

Oracle8教程掌握数据库新技能

确保数据库有足够的内存和磁盘空间。

定期分析和调整数据库参数以优化性能。

5、学习备份和恢复策略

备份和恢复是保护数据库免受数据丢失的关键过程,要确保您的数据库始终可用,您需要了解如何备份和恢复数据,以下是一些备份和恢复策略:

定期备份数据,并将备份文件存储在安全的地方。

测试恢复过程,以确保在发生故障时可以成功恢复数据。

如果可能的话,使用分布式备份策略来保护数据免受灾难性事件的影响。

根据业务需求制定合适的恢复时间目标(RTO)和恢复点目标(RPO)。

相关问题与解答:

问题1:如何在Oracle 8中创建一个新用户?

答:要在Oracle 8中创建一个新用户,您可以使用“create user”命令,要创建一个名为“newuser”的用户,您可以运行以下命令:create user newuser identified by password;“password”是您为该用户设置的密码。

问题2:如何优化Oracle 8中的查询性能?

答:要优化Oracle 8中的查询性能,您可以采取以下措施:确保表有适当的索引;优化查询语句,避免全表扫描和笛卡尔积操作;使用分区表来提高查询性能;确保数据库有足够的内存和磁盘空间;定期分析和调整数据库参数以优化性能。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/388714.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-03-28 07:28
Next 2024-03-28 07:31

相关推荐

  • 利用oracle实现工序优化设置的方法

    在制造业中,工序优化是提高生产效率、降低成本和保证产品质量的重要手段,利用Oracle数据库系统实现工序优化设置可以通过集成的数据管理和高效的数据处理能力,帮助企业更好地规划和控制生产流程,以下将详细介绍如何利用Oracle实现工序优化设置。数据模型构建在Oracle中进行工序优化前,需要构建一个合理的数据模型来表示工序信息,这个模型……

    2024-04-11
    0147
  • 一切构建在Oracle 17009上

    一切构建在Oracle 17009上Oracle数据库的每一次版本更新都带来了性能的提升、新功能的增加以及安全性的加强,Oracle 17009作为Oracle数据库管理与配置的一部分,其重要性不言而喻,本文将深入探讨Oracle 17009的关键技术细节,帮助读者理解其工作原理及应用场景。Oracle 17009概述Oracle 1……

    2024-04-04
    0154
  • 利用oracle轻松达至更高境界

    在当今企业级应用和云基础设施中,Oracle数据库系统以其强大的功能、可靠性和性能而著称,它不仅提供了高效的数据存储和管理解决方案,还支持复杂的事务处理和数据分析需求,以下是如何利用Oracle数据库系统轻松达至更高境界的详细介绍:高效数据管理Oracle数据库提供了多种工具和特性来优化数据管理过程,包括:1、先进的SQL处理能力:通……

    2024-04-11
    0162
  • 与使用oracle数组定义与应用技巧的关系

    Oracle数据库是一种广泛使用的企业级关系型数据库管理系统,它提供了许多高级功能,其中之一就是数组,数组是一组相同类型的数据元素的集合,它们在内存中连续存储,在Oracle数据库中,可以使用PL/SQL语言来定义和使用数组,本文将介绍如何使用Oracle数组定义与应用技巧。1、定义数组在Oracle数据库中,可以使用DECLARE语……

    2024-03-28
    0101
  • 如何删除oracle表空间

    在Oracle数据库中,表空间是存储数据库对象(如表、索引、视图等)数据的基本单位,当表空间被填满或者需要优化存储空间时,可能需要删除表空间,本文将介绍如何删除Oracle中的表空间。删除表空间的前提条件在删除表空间之前,需要确保以下几点:1、没有用户正在使用该表空间,如果有用户正在使用表空间,需要先将其迁移到其他表空间。2、没有对象……

    2024-03-27
    0102
  • 给企业带来更高生产效率OA与Oracle的集成之路

    在当今的企业运营中,提高生产效率是每个企业都在追求的目标,为了实现这一目标,许多企业开始寻求各种方法,OA系统(办公自动化系统)与Oracle数据库的集成是一个有效的解决方案,本文将详细介绍如何实现OA与Oracle的集成,以提高企业的生产效率。OA系统与Oracle数据库的集成概述OA系统是一种能够提高企业工作效率,减少人力资源浪费……

    2024-03-26
    0156

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入